Job Summary:

To oversee the human resources of the company and ensure alignment between the human capital needs and the organizations strategic direction through staffing, deployment, performance management, reward, welfare, health and safety among other HR issues.

Duties and Responsibilities:

Reporting to the Managing Director, the main duties will include but not limited to the following;
  • Manage staff recruitment and staffing across the organization.
  • Develop human resource policies and ensure compliance with the same.
  • Carry out Training needs assessment and training to bridge the skills and competence gap in the company or recommend training interventions.
  • Manage staff deployment in the head office as well as in the field sites
  • Manage the staff payroll and ensure it remains within budgetary estimates
  • Manage talent and ensure good performers are rewarded appropriately
  • Handle day to day HR duties relating to staff like leave administration, records keeping , staff
  • file maintenance among others
  • Develop manpower and other HR plans that are needed for other operations of the company
  • Manage staff discipline and cohesion by ensuring harmony among all staff and diverse teams
  • Manage performance management and continuous productivity improvement
  • Any other duties that may be allocated by management from time to time
Person Specifications
  • A degree in Education/ Social Science/Human Resources/ Business administration or Commerce
  • A professional diploma or higher diploma in Human Resources from a recognized body will be a definite advantage.
  • 3 years’ experience managing HR in an architecture, technical, specialist, construction or project based organization.
  • Demonstrated people leadership and love for working for and with people
  • Soberness, maturity and high levels of integrity
  • Ability to spot and nurture talent
  • A good communicator able to learn and manage people
